Filing 10 MEMORANDUM AND ORDER ON SEALED SUBMISSIONS: The application to seal the petition, as well as all submissions in support or opposition to the petition, is DENIED WITHOUT PREJUDICE. Either party may make a more tailored application to redact certain specific material, provided it is supported by an affidavit or declaration from a knowledgeable witness explaining the nature of the privacy interest, the harm from disclosure and any prior disclosures of the material to third parties, e.g. regulatory authorities. The application should be accompanied by redacted and unredacted copies of the material. (Signed by Judge P. Kevin Castel on 1/6/2015) (lmb) |
